VPN与SSH都是网络安全技术,但区别明显。VPN主要保障数据传输的隐私和完整性,适用于远程访问和跨国数据传输;SSH则侧重于加密和认证,多用于服务器安全管理和远程登录。具体选择应根据实际需求和环境来定。
VPN与SSH的区别
1. 工作原理
VPN:通过构建一个加密的虚拟隧道,确保用户终端与远程服务器间的数据传输加密,保障传输过程的安全性。
SSH:一种网络协议,旨在实现计算机之间的安全通信和数据传输,SSH协议通过加密算法对传输数据进行加密,确保传输过程的安全性。
2. 适用场景
VPN:适用于企业、个人用户远程访问内网资源、跨国公司分支机构间的数据传输、网络应用层的加密等。
SSH:适用于远程登录、文件传输、远程命令执行等场景,尤其是在确保远程操作安全性的情况下。
3. 性能
VPN:由于加密处理,连接速度相对较慢,但数据传输过程中对网络性能的影响较小。
SSH:加密算法相对简单,连接速度较快,但在数据传输过程中对网络性能的影响较大。
4. 安全性
VPN:采用加密算法对数据传输进行加密,安全性较高,但若VPN服务器遭受攻击,整个网络可能面临风险。
SSH:同样采用加密算法,安全性较高,但若SSH服务器被攻击,攻击者可能获取用户的登录凭证,进而获取更多权限。
5. 配置与使用
VPN:需配置VPN客户端和服务器,对网络环境有一定要求,配置相对复杂,但安全性较高。
SSH:配置简单,仅需在客户端和服务器上安装SSH软件,但安全性相对较低,需用户自行管理密钥。
VPN与SSH的适用场景分析
1. 远程办公
VPN:适用于远程办公场景,员工可通过VPN连接公司内网,实现文件共享、协同办公等功能。
SSH:适用于需要远程登录服务器进行操作的场景,如管理员远程登录服务器进行维护、配置等。
2. 数据传输
VPN:适用于跨国公司分支机构间的数据传输,确保数据传输的安全性。
SSH:适用于小规模数据传输,如文件传输、远程命令执行等。
3. 网络安全
VPN:在网络安全方面,VPN具有更高的安全性,可有效防止数据泄露、攻击等风险。
SSH:在网络安全方面,SSH的安全性相对较低,但可通过配置SSH密钥提高安全性。
VPN与SSH在实现远程访问和数据加密方面具有相似的功能,但在工作原理、适用场景、性能、安全性和配置使用等方面存在显著差异,用户在选择VPN或SSH时,应根据实际需求、网络环境等因素进行综合考虑,在实际应用中,VPN和SSH可以相互配合,共同保障网络安全。
未经允许不得转载! 作者:烟雨楼,转载或复制请以超链接形式并注明出处快连vpn。
原文地址:https://le-tsvpn.com/vpnpingjia/42260.html发布于:2024-11-10
还没有评论,来说两句吧...